Based upon case counts maintained by RALJ Public Defender <br /> and reviewed by the City, the Projected Case Count represents current estimates for annual case <br /> counts for all indigent cases filed by the City likely to be assigned to RALJ Public Defender.The <br /> terms"case"and"credit"shall be defined in accordance with the Washington State Supreme Court <br /> rule and Washington Office of Public Defense guidelines. <br /> 2.2 Adjustment;Internal Allocation. As provided in the Standards,case counts <br /> may be revised upwards based upon a variety of factors. Upon the RALJ Public Defender's <br /> request, the City shall review any particular case with the RALJ Public Defender to determine <br /> whether greater weighting should be assigned, and upward revisions shall not be unreasonably <br /> refused. The annual caseload shall be reviewed annually on or about June 30th each year. <br /> 2.3 Compensation. Except as expressly provided in Section 2.4,the cost of all <br /> infrastructure,administrative, support and systems as well as standard overhead services necessary <br /> to comply with the established standards are provided for in the cost per case payment provided in <br /> Section 2 above. <br /> 2.4 Payments in Addition to the Compensation.
